Eighteen months ago on this blog I discussed the launch of BookTrack – an application which adds a ‘soundscape’ to books to enhance the reading experience. As I pointed out at the time, this may be a mixed blessing. Whilst it may add considerably to the the reader’s enjoyment, it runs an equal risk of spoiling it. What if the music seems wrong, or the sounds intrusive?

Since I first wrote it, my little story about the ‘Littlest Star’ has been on quite a roller coaster journey. With each new development and opportunity it has grown more precious to me. Book signings, recordings, broadcasts and readings have all added to it. How would I feel, then, when somebody gave my little story the BookTrack treatment?

When The Littlest Star was broadcast for the first time on December 23rd 2012, it came complete with musical backing…and I loved it. I am now able to offer this musical version as a download.
